Was ist im Zusammenhang mit JBoss und Wildfly der Unterschied zwischen einem Modul und einem Subsystem?Was ist der Unterschied zwischen einem Modul und einem Subsystem?
Antwort
Jboss Module ist ein Klasse-Ladesystem:
JBoss-Module ist eine eigenständige Implementierung eines modularen (nicht-hierarchische) Klasse Lade- und Ausführungsumgebung für Java. Mit anderen Worten, statt eines einzelnen Klassenladeprogramms, das alle JARs in einen flachen Klassenpfad lädt, wird jede Bibliothek zu einem Modul, das nur mit den exakten Modulen verknüpft ist, von denen es abhängt, und nicht mehr. Es implementiert ein threadsicheres, schnelles und hochgradig gleichzeitig delegierendes Klassenladermodell, das mit einem erweiterbaren Modulauflösungssystem gekoppelt ist, die sich zu einem einzigartigen, einfachen und leistungsfähigen System für die Anwendungsausführung und -verteilung kombinieren. Guide for Class Loading in WildFly
Subsystems sind die Gruppen der anpassbaren Funktionen des Jboss:
Die EE-Subsystem gemeinsame Funktionalität in der Java-EE-Plattform bietet, wie beispielsweise die EE Concurrency Utilities (JSR 236) und @Resource Injektions . Das Subsystem ist auch für die Verwaltung des Lebenszyklus von Implementierungen der Java EE-Anwendung verantwortlich, also EAR-Dateien. Die EE-Subsystem-Konfiguration verwendet werden können: die Bereitstellung von Java EE-Anwendungen anpassen, erstellen EE Instanzen Concurrency Utilities, definieren die Standardbindungen Guide for subsystem configuration
- 1. Unterschied zwischen einem Subsystem und einer Komponente
- 2. Was ist der Unterschied zwischen einer Schließung und einem Modul?
- 3. Was ist der Unterschied zwischen einem Anwendungscontroller und einem Anwendungskontext?
- 4. Was ist der Unterschied zwischen einem Muster und einem Pfad?
- 5. Was ist der Unterschied zwischen einem Primärschlüssel und einem Ersatzschlüssel?
- 6. Was ist der Unterschied zwischen einem Integrator und einem Tiefpassfilter?
- 7. Was ist der Unterschied zwischen einem Index und einem Fremdschlüssel?
- 8. Was ist der Unterschied zwischen einem Controller und einem Service?
- 9. Was ist der Unterschied zwischen einem RoutedCommand und einem RoutedUICommand?
- 10. Was ist der Unterschied zwischen einem Key und einem KeySpec?
- 11. Was ist der Unterschied zwischen einem Streamwriter und einem Binarywriter?
- 12. Was ist der Unterschied zwischen einem Token und einem Digest?
- 13. Was ist der Unterschied zwischen einem Array und einem Objekt?
- 14. Was ist der Unterschied zwischen einem Tabellenindex und einem Ansichtsindex?
- 15. Was ist der Unterschied zwischen einem Domänenklassendiagramm und einem Designklassendiagramm?
- 16. Was ist der Unterschied zwischen einem Tupel und einem compressed_pair?
- 17. Was ist der Unterschied zwischen einem Klassendiagramm und einem Objektdiagramm?
- 18. Was ist der Unterschied zwischen einem Iterator und einem Generator?
- 19. Was ist der Unterschied zwischen einem ReadOnlyDictionary und einem ImmutableDictionary?
- 20. Was ist der Unterschied zwischen einem Nanokern und einem Exokernel?
- 21. Was ist der Unterschied zwischen einem Algorithmus und einem Entwurfsmuster
- 22. Was ist der Unterschied zwischen einem Helfer und einem Teil?
- 23. Was ist der Unterschied zwischen einem Feature und einem Label?
- 24. Was ist der Unterschied zwischen einem Workflow und einem Flowchart?
- 25. Was ist der Unterschied zwischen einem Instanzinitialisierer und einem Konstruktor?
- 26. Was ist der Unterschied zwischen einem Prozess und einem Prozessabbild?
- 27. Was ist der Unterschied zwischen einem ViewModel und einem Controller?
- 28. Unterschied zwischen einem geladenen Modul und einem initialisierten Modul?
- 29. Was ist der Unterschied zwischen einem Maven-Modul und einem Maven-Projekt?
- 30. Was ist der Unterschied zwischen einem Namespace und einem Modul in F #?